Ohio American Indian and Alaska Native Alone Male or Men Population By County in 2020

Updated on July 3,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2020, the American Indian and Alaska Native Alone male population in Ohio was 18,102 and represented 0.31% of the total Ohio male population (5,820,237).

Among Ohio counties, Franklin County had the highest American Indian and Alaska Native Alone male population (2,329), followed by Cuyahoga County (1,617), and Hamilton County (1,201).
